ilya-biryukov wrote:
There is also a similar use of the name in `CheckCoroutineWrapper`, I suggest
to unify the check for matching this particular function across the two call
sites.
The motivation to disable this for `get_return_object` is clear: it's often
used as an implementation detail, so warning there creates noise. There could
be better ways to do it, though.
